How Many Students Appeared for CLAT 2026: NLUs are spread across around 22 states and a union territory, Delhi, making it reasonable to have a Common Law Admission Test. Consolidating all NLUs (except NLU Delhi and NLU Meghalaya) into the CLAT Consortium also helped the law entrance exam become one of the most sought-after entrance exams for the study of law. As a result, over 60,000 candidates have appeared in CLAT every year since 2018. The CLAT registrations spiked to 75,183 in 2020, followed by a gradual decline. After touching a low of 54,253 in 2023, the registration improved again in 2024 and rose to 71,243 and then 78,914 in 2025 .

How Many Students Appeared for CLAT 2026

According to the CLAT Consortium, a total of 92,344 candidates registered for CLAT 2026. Out of them, 88,657 candidates appeared for the exam. When separated course-wise, 75,009 students registered for CLAT UG, and 72,631 appeared in the UG exam. For CLAT PG, 17,335 students registered, and 16,026 appeared for the exam.

This is the highest participation ever recorded in the history of CLAT. The increase shows that more students are preparing for law careers and want to join top NLUs.

In CLAT 2025, a total of 78,914 candidates registered, and 75,361 students appeared. For CLAT PG 2025, 16,082 candidates registered, and 14,817 appeared. Below is the course-wise data for the CLAT 2025 exam.

Number of students who appeared for CLAT 2025 exam
Exam name Registered for CLAT 2025 Appeared in CLAT 2025 Absent
CLAT UG 62,832 60,544 2,288
CLAT PG 16,082 14,817 1,265
Total 78,914 75,361 3,553

How Many Candidates Appear for CLAT Every Year - Last 5 Years

This table shows the number of candidates who registered and appeared for CLAT during the past five years. It helps students understand the growth in competition.

How Many Candidates Appear for CLAT Every Year - Last 5 Years

Year Total registered Total appeared
2025 78,914 75,361
2024 71,243 68,786
2023 54,253 51,469
2022 60,895 56,472
2021 70,277 62,107
2020 75,183 59,443
